Editing a Road Alignment
To edit an alignment, you can either modify the geometry and redefine the
alignment, or you can modify the alignment data from within the
Horizontal Alignment Editor.
Use the Horizontal Alignment Editor to modify individual curve, tangent,
and spiral geometry, and to generate reports based on the alignment. After
you save the changes, drawing objects are automatically updated, so you do
not need to redefine the alignment geometry.
